Graduates of the Programs in Sustainable International Development, both those from southern nations as well as those from the U.S. and Europe, have enhanced career opportunities and are currently working in development organizations in the U.S. and throughout the world. SID staff and faculty offer on-going career counseling for all graduates of the program.
